How much do full time veterinary surgeon j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time veterinary surgeon in the United States is $37.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$44.71 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Where do full time veterinary surgeons make the most money?

Full-time veterinary surgeons tend to earn higher salaries in regions with a higher cost of living and greater demand for veterinary services, such as urban areas or affluent communities. Salaries are also influenced by experience, specialization, and the type of practice, with those working in emergency or specialty clinics often earning more than general practitioners.

Why are so many full time veterinary surgeons quitting?

Many full-time veterinary surgeons are quitting due to high levels of stress, long working hours, and emotional burnout from dealing with sick animals and distressed pet owners. Additionally, workload pressures, administrative tasks, and limited work-life balance contribute to job dissatisfaction and turnover in the profession.

How many hours does a full time veterinary surgeon work?

A full-time veterinary surgeon typically works around 40 hours per week, often scheduled during regular business hours with some evenings or weekends required. Overtime may be necessary during emergencies or busy periods, and shift work can vary depending on the practice setting.
